Hi, All we know that the only thing that stops people from use of Qt Extended as main distro is lack of Mokomaze :) I've decided to learn QtE a little and already rewrited Mokomaze 0.2 to use Qt. The port is named QtMaze and there are its benefits: * it works * it can be included in distro ;)
Anti-dim-and-suspend functionality is built in and seems to work fine. Up-to-date extended levelpack is also included. There is a new feature: keep level switching button pressed to fast-forward/fast-rewind. Known problem: the game will go to fullscreen mode properly only after enabling/disabling screen lock.
